excel学习库

excel表格_excel函数公式大全_execl从入门到精通

又想到一个很多列求和、对账的新方法,即使有8个条件也不怕!

先看问题,上面是原始数据,要根据B-H列提取不重复值,再统计管理费用。

问题并不难,就是列数有点多,处理起来不太方便而已。

1.常规方法

将B-H列的内容复制到下方,点数据,删除重复值,确定。这样就提取不重复值。

管理费用,多条件求和就是SUMIFS函数,不过列数太多,写起来确实不方便。

=SUMIFS($I$2:$I$11,$B$2:$B$11,B15,$C$2:$C$11,C15,$D$2:$D$11,D15,$E$2:$E$11,E15,$F$2:$F$11,F15,$G$2:$G$11,G15,$H$2:$H$11,H15)

当然,也可以用透视表,不过列数太多,拉起来也不是很方便,但是比写公式简单多了。

2.辅助列大法

直接处理起来麻烦,那就间接处理,轩哥就特别喜欢用辅助列。

既然列数太多,那就用TEXTJOIN函数将内容合并成一列。同理,下面的也合并起来。

=TEXTJOIN("、",1,B2:H2)

现在就转变成单条件求和,直接用SUMIF函数就可以,这样看起来公式更加简洁。

=SUMIF($J$2:$J$11,J15,$I$2:$I$11)

同理,假如现在有2个表格,列数都很多,要核对所有列是否一样,也可以用这种辅助列大法。

合并后就变成一列,直接用COUNTIF函数,次数为1的就是一样,0就是不同。

处理完,如果觉得辅助列影响美观,可以直接右键将列隐藏起来即可。

发表评论:

◎欢迎参与讨论,请在这里发表您的看法、交流您的观点。

«    2024年12月    »
1
2345678
9101112131415
16171819202122
23242526272829
3031
控制面板
您好,欢迎到访网站!
  查看权限
网站分类
搜索
最新留言
    文章归档
      友情链接